𝗔 𝗟𝗘𝗚𝗔𝗖𝗬 𝗢𝗙 𝗦𝗘𝗥𝗩𝗜𝗖𝗘, 𝗦𝗧𝗥𝗘𝗡𝗚𝗧𝗛, 𝗔𝗡𝗗 𝗥𝗘𝗡𝗘𝗪𝗔𝗟
My dearest Members of Action for Development in Nchum Community (ADENCO), since 2004, leading ADENCO has been far more than a mandate for me—it has been an extraordinary human adventure. Together, we have gone through thick and thin, overcome obstacles that at times seemed insurmountable, celebrated exhilarating milestones, and braved storms of every magnitude. At each step, your dedication and loyalty made all the difference.
At a time when we are gradually becoming a financially sustainable organization given our flagship project- The Investment Fund with its high potential and a symbol of a brighter future for us, I pay tribute to all members, both old and new, who have walked this journey with me, and I extend my heartfelt gratitude to the various Executive Committees for their tireless work and unwavering sense of duty. Thanks to you, these 22 years have been one of the most rewarding and fulfilling experiences of my life.
It is with immense gratitude that I celebrate you all for accepting my decision made known at the start of the just-ended mandate to allow me step back for a well-deserved rest. I step back humbly, yet with deep peace of mind, knowing that ADENCO’s future is secure. The new leadership will be carried by someone who has been carefully selected, prepared, groomed, and shaped for succession—a true sign of organizational maturity and long-term vision.
I warmly congratulate the Executive President-Elect, Mr. Shunganui Abongnwi, my bold candidate, and welcome him into this noble and demanding mission: leading an organization as transformative and exemplary as ADENCO toward new horizons. I settle into my rest with full confidence, convinced that we are heading toward better days—driven by a renewed vision and new rays of hope.
Words can’t describe the feeling, level of peace and satisfaction when you get to the point where you can sit back and watch an organization you’ve labored for years to build, gather steam and speed on without you in the driver’s seat.
Abongta S Moncha
Outgoing Executive President
